We have a teenage only-child who is very active in sports. He mainly uses his scooter to get around. If we have to haul kids, my wife's GC is called on. My 2-door Rubi keeps me out of the child chauffeuring business, for the most part... a bonus. The 2-door is awesome to drive (a little unruly over 80, so try not to go there) and with Goodyear Wrangler Duratrac tires on OEM rims, looks beefy enough to not sucker me into lifts, etc... that frequently degrade ride quality and vehicle endurance (and continue to rack up Jeep ?investment? costs).
